#13ba03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13ba03 is composed of 7.5% red, 72.9%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 114.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 37.1%. #13ba03 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ff06 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#13ba03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13ba03 has RGB values of R:19, G:186,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1292803.

Shades and Tints of #13ba03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c00 is the darkest color, while #f9f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#13ba03
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b635a is the less saturated color, while #13ba03 is the most saturated one.
